A Review of the House’s Edge
If you are a refreshing gamer, or if you are a rookie gamer, then you may have heard the terminology "House Edge," and considered what it means. Many persons imagine that the House Edge is the ratio of accumulated $$$$$ lost to summed up dollars wagered, anyway, this is not the case. In fact, the House Edge is a ratio made from the average loss contrasted to the first stake. This ratio is crucial to know when making bets at the several casino games as it tells you what gambles give you a improved probability of winning, and which stakes provide the House an intriguing opportunity.
The House Edge in Table Games
Being aware of the House’s Edge ratio for the casino table games that you have fun playing is extremely critical considering that if you do not know which gambles provision you the more adequate odds of winning you can waste your funds. A single case of this appears in the game of craps. In this game the inside propositional bets can have a House Edge ratio of about sixteen per cent, while the line bets and 6 and eight plays have a much depreciated 1.5 percent House Edge. This e.g. certainly exhibits the impact that knowing the House Edge ratios can have on your success at a table game. Other House Edge ratios are comprised of: 1.06 per cent for Baccarat when betting on the banker, 1.24 % in Baccarat when casting bets on the player, 14.36 % when casting bets on a tie.
The House Edge in Casino Poker
Poker games taken part in at casinos also have a House’s Edge to take into awareness. If you anticipate on playing Double Down Stud the House’s Edge usually will be 2.67 percentage. If you play Pai Gow Poker the House’s Edge will surely be in the midst of 1.5 percentage and 1.46 percent. If you like to play Three Card Poker the House’s Edge will most likely be from 2.32 percentage and 3.37 per cent banking on the concept of the game. And if you try Video Poker the House’s Edge is simply 0.46 percent if you play a Jacks or Better video poker machine.
